What is remote construction software?

Remote construction software refers to digital tools and platforms designed to help construction teams plan, manage, and collaborate on projects from different locations. These solutions typically offer features such as project scheduling, document management, real-time communication, and progress tracking. By using remote construction software, teams can work efficiently without being physically present at the construction site, which improves coordination, reduces errors, and saves time. Popular examples include Procore, Autodesk Construction Cloud, and Buildertrend.

How does working on a remote construction software team typically differ from traditional on-site construction roles in terms of collaboration and workflow?

Remote construction software teams frequently collaborate across multiple time zones and disciplines, making digital communication and project management tools essential. Unlike traditional on-site roles, much of the interaction happens through virtual meetings, shared platforms, and cloud-based document management. This environment requires strong self-motivation, proactive communication, and adaptability to evolving technologies. Team members often coordinate closely with architects, engineers, and construction managers to ensure digital solutions align with project needs and timelines.

The Federal Savings Bank is hiring a Construction Draw Administrator to support our offices nationwide.


The Federal Savings Bank is a national bank headquartered in Chicago, IL, specializing primarily in residential mortgage lending. We are proudly veteran-owned and dedicated to providing white glove service to all of our customers and business partners.


The Construction Draw Administrator is a crucial role responsible for ensuring the proper facilitation of draw disbursements while maintaining compliance with loan documentation, credit policy, internal procedures, and applicable state and federal laws. The administrator will act as the primary point of contact for builders, managing disbursements and ensuring projects are tracked accurately during the construction period.


Ideal candidates are available for a hybrid schedule (3 days onsite in our Chicago/Logan Square headquarters). Fully remote qualified candidates will be considered on a case by case basis and are encouraged to apply.


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Facilitate draw disbursements in compliance with loan documentation and credit policies
  • Act as a conduit for communication between builders and the bank during the draw process
  • Ensure all projects are tracked and managed efficiently and accurately within the construction period
  • Maintain detailed records of all correspondence and transactions related to disbursements
  • Collaborate with various departments to ensure smooth processing of draw requests
  • Adhere to The Federal Savings Bank's communication standards and procedures
